What the college says

The aim of the Physics A Level at Highbury Fields School is to provide a comprehensive education in Physics in preparation for continued study and a deeper understanding of the universe in which they live. The objectives are to enable students to develop: Essential knowledge and understanding of different areas of the subject and how they relate to each other A deep appreciation of the skills, knowledge and understanding of scientific methods Competence and confidence in a variety of practical, mathematical and problem solving skills Their interest in and enthusiasm for the subject, including developing an interest in further study and careers associated with the subject An understanding of how society makes decisions about scientific issues and how the sciences contribute to the success of the economy and society.

What you need to get on

6 GCSEs at Grade C or above including minimum grade B in English & Maths and minimum BB in double award science or BBB in triple award science
